摘 要:Objectives To investigate the effects of simvastatin on membrane ionic currents in left ventricular myocytes of rabbit heart suffering from acute myocardial infarction ( AMI), so as to explore the ionic mechanism of statin treatment for antiarrhythmia. Methods Forty-five New Zealand rabbits were randomly divided into three groups: AMI group, simvastatin intervention group ( Statin group) and sham-operated control group (CON). Rabbits were infarcted by ligation of the left anterior descending coronary artery after administration of oral simvastatin 5 mg · kg^-1·d^-1 (Statin group) or placebo (AMI group) for 3 days. Single ventricular myocytes were isolated enzymatically from the epicardial zone of the infracted region 72 h later. Whole cell patch clamp technique was used to record membrane ionic currents, including sodium current (INa), L-type calcium current (Ica-L) and transient outward potassium current (Ito). Results (1) There was not significant difference in serum cholesterol concentration among three groups. (2) The peak INa current density (at -30 mV) was significantly decreased in AMI group ( -25.26±5.28, n = 13 ), comparing with CON ( - 42. 78± 5.48, n = 16), P 〈 0. 05, while it was significantly increased in Statin group ( - 39.83 ±5.65 pA/pF, n = 12) comparing with AMI group, P 〈0. 01 ; The peak Ica-L current density ( at 0 mV) was significantly decreased in AMI group ( -3. 43 ±0. 92 pA/pF, n = 13) comparing with CON ( -4. 56 ±1.01 pA/pF, n = 15), P 〈0. 05, while it was significantly increased in Statin group ( -4. 18±0. 96 pA/pF, n = 12) comparing with AMI group, P 〈0. 05; The Ito current density ( at + 60 mV) was significantly decreased in AMI group ( 11.41 ± 1.94 pA/pF, n = 13 ) comparing with CON (17.41 ±3.13 pA/pF, n = 15), P 〈0. 01, while it was significantly increased in Statin group (16. 11 ± 2. 43 pA/pF, n = 14) comparing with AMI group, P 〈 0. 01.
